Transaction 62a0877120e234f63fa84519ecda310fde28f6203d6e0e7b898957f811c28bc5

2 Input
2 Outputs
  • 62a0877120e234f63fa84519ecda310fde28f6203d6e0e7b898957f811c28bc5:0
  • value  999782
    address  2NG7XxaQsEBaTNBwee7TgQ44gimg7GffzJP
  • 62a0877120e234f63fa84519ecda310fde28f6203d6e0e7b898957f811c28bc5:1
  • value  14212
    address  2MvzYcGWTQvpawsoWhEmeZiS3bgMTbLVU9C